The Consequences of Poor Waste Management

Poor waste management has numerous consequences, from environmental pollution and public health issues to economic costs and social repercussions. When waste is not managed properly, it can contaminate soil and water, contribute to climate change, and harbor disease-carrying pests and rodents. Additionally, inadequate waste disposal can result in increased operational costs, as well as damaged infrastructure and affected property values.

Principles of Effective Waste Management

A successful waste management strategy must adopt the following principles:

  • Segregation**: Sort waste into categories, such as recyclables, organics, and non-recyclables.
  • Diversion**: Focus on reducing the amount of waste sent to landfills and increasing recycling rates.
  • Design**: Incorporate waste reduction into product design and packaging.
  • Education**: Raise awareness and promote behavioral changes among citizens to encourage responsible waste disposal.
  • Infrastructure**: Invest in robust waste management infrastructure, including facilities and transportation networks.

Tactics for Successful Waste Management

To successfully implement waste management strategies, it is essential to adopt the following tactics:

  • Municipal Cooperation**: Encourage collaboration between municipal governments, local businesses, and community groups.
  • Partnerships**: Foster partnerships between waste management stakeholders, including NGOs, private sector companies, and research institutions.
  • Regulatory Framework**: Establish and enforce regulations to guide waste management practices and ensure compliance.
  • Tech Integration**: Leverage innovative technologies, such as waste sorting machines and analytics software, to optimize waste collection and processing.

Successful Waste Management Strategies in Practice

Many cities and communities around the world have successfully implemented waste management strategies, resulting in significant reductions in waste sent to landfills. For example:

  • Bangkok’s Waste-to-Wealth Project**: A multi-stakeholder initiative that includes waste segregation, recycling, and composting has reduced the city’s waste disposal costs by 30%.
  • The "Zero Waste" City**: The city of Vancouver has established a comprehensive waste management plan that aims to eliminate waste sent to landfills and achieve a recycling rate of 70%.
  • Korea’s Nationwide Recycling Program**: A national initiative that includes recycling education, facility construction, and waste sorting has increased Korea’s recycling rate from 10% to 50% in the past decade.
